Output 65c628d04c1a2dc4f5fd9fcb2611de06bba9c94de0f033f6f7bd42883a824476:1

value
280896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07690053709ca08513407f115ff0dde83bf2931c OP_EQUAL
address
32NCSW877Rh4cps7iP2QCoJnDW7VFV8AS5
transaction
65c628d04c1a2dc4f5fd9fcb2611de06bba9c94de0f033f6f7bd42883a824476
confirmations
248674
spent
true